My client is a highly respected UK Top 100 law firm, renowned not only for its real estate expertise but also as a market leader in the charities and not-for-profit sector. This is a rare opportunity to join a team recognised as one of the leading practices in this field across the South East and Greater London, advising on some of the most interesting and impactful matters in the market.

The role offers exposure to a diverse and rewarding caseload, including property transactions, leasehold and freehold matters, and strategic advisory work for charitable organisations and not-for-profits. You will work on technically complex and high-profile matters that demand both commercial acumen and a deep understanding of the legal framework governing this sector.

This is an outstanding opportunity for a solicitor with a genuine interest in real estate and charity law to develop specialist expertise within a highly regarded team.
